Please reference the permit application received in our office on June 22, 2005, submitted
on your behalf by Mr. Christopher Huysman of Wetland and Natural Resource Consultants, Inc.,
for individual Department of the Army (DA) permit authorization for the proposed placement of
fill material into 0.04 acre of wetlands and 1,318 linear feet of stream channel, and the flooding
of 6,714 linear feet of stream channel associated with the construction of three impoundments
and two road crossings necessary for the development Lissara Subdivision. The project is
approximately 132 acres in size and is located to the north of Shallowford Road and west of
Conrad Road, in Lewisville, Forsyth County, North Carolina.
By letter dated July 26, 2007, we notified you that we had concurred that your revised
plan received on February 9, 2006, includes a lake of reasonable dimensions (i.e. both length and
width) for a waterskiing lake. This letter also requested that you provide additional information
including a mitigation plan for the proposed impacts. To date, you have not responded to these
requests. Without the requested information we cannot continue the processing of your
application. Accordingly, your Department of the Army (DA) permit application has been
retired.
If you wish to continue to pursue a DA permit, you must first respond to the referenced
letter addressing all the identified comments and provide the requested information. With the
requested information, you will also need to re-submit your application for a DA permit for your
proposed project.
